    Thank you very much, Jack MVP.  I downloaded and installed ServiWin as directed by your recommendation.

    It showed me that the server SMB 1. XXX driver (srv.sys) was not working.  I then used the 'Google - executable name' search option from right-click menu.

    This showed me in turn to the web page of "http://support.microsoft.com/kb/2473205" entitled: "list of currently available patches for technologies in Windows Server 2008 and Windows Server 2008 R2 file Services.

    In this page, I found a section entitled SRV component with a link to the article 2625434 knowledge base: "http://support.microsoft.com/hotfix/KBHotfix.aspx?kbnum=2625434&kbln=en-us."

    This allowed me to download an a security update that contains the latest version of the srv.sys.  Installation of this repaired my faulty installation of the SMB 1. XXX driver.

    This then allowed me to do things like "View the HomeGroup Password" and "Leave the HomeGroup" that I couldn't do before.

    I was then able to join the homegroup, and after restarting, become visible to my laptop.

    I then told the phone leaving the homegroup and then join and now computers are visible to each other.

    All Windows 7 computers on my home network are now visible to the other in the homegroup.

    How to access and manipulate the results of a method of filling via
    ActionScript? I am currently using Beta3.

    Note that it takes time to actually make the dataservice call and retrieve the results. Your data will be unavailable immediately. After calling fill(), you must wait for the "result" of the DataService object event.
